Chapter 13

The real complications didn’t set in at once. It took another storm to set loose a chain of events from which there might be no return. But before that Nicole was pleasantly surprised by how much fun she was having with Lucien and her lovely Yum-Yum. Everyone was enchanted by Yum-Yum and Popcorn, with the possible exception of Bojangles. The first time he encountered the puppies the look on his face was priceless.

That night they were all in the big sunroom at Ruth and Mac’s house. Corey had brought Popcorn over to meet her grandparents, and Nicole and Lucien had brought Yum-Yum so she could bond with her sister. Bojangles came into the room and the puppies went running past him so fast they didn’t seem to see him. He saw them, however, and he almost passed out. His look said, “What in the world have you brought into this house?” so plainly that everyone laughed, and he was so offended he left the room in a huff. Nicole was the first one to express concern for him.

“I think we hurt his feelings,” she said. “I hope he gets used to the puppies. He’s bound to see them around from time to time.”

Mac assured her that he’d get used to it. “My bride and I are going to Hawaii next week, so he’ll have plenty of time to adjust. Feel free to bring them over every day if you want. He could use some exercise, and I think those little ones will provide it.”

Lucien raised an eyebrow. “You’re going to Hawaii? How come?”

Mac put his arm around Ruth and kissed her neck. “We’re newlyweds, if you recall, and we don’t need a reason to get away. We’re also grown, and we don’t need permission to leave town.”

Ruth smiled at her husband’s answer, but she ex-plained,”We’re going to Hawaii to sell my cottage. I don’t use it that much, and I decided to sell it and use the proceeds for hurricane relief. But first we’re going to enjoy it together for a few days,” she said, giving Mac a beautiful smile.

Nicole was about to tell Ruth how much she admired her generous gesture when Mac fixed Lucien with a stern gaze. “We’re counting on you to take care of our guest while we’re gone. This is a big house, and it can get lonely for one person. Everyone else has left for new homes now that rebuilding has begun. You keep an eye out for her, hear?”

Lucien gave his father a look that was completely serious and assured him that Nicole’s comfort was his only concern. “Don’t worry, Judge, I’ve got this,” he said. Then he flashed Nicole a bold yet intimate smile. “I’m like that insurance company, baby. You’ll be in good hands with me.”

His words were reassuring, but the look in his eyes was anything but. This was just what she didn’t need, more temptation. She was trying to listen to something Ruth was saying to her while she was taking a guarded look at Lucien.
